TF1 has posted a year-on-year decline in operating profit and ad revenues in the first quarter of 2012.
France’s largest commercial broadcaster reported a 2.3% year-on-year increase in overall revenue of €628.6 million, but advertising revenues of €339.5 million were down 3.9% and quarterly operating profit of €56 million compared with €61 million a year earlier.
The broadcaster said it was sticking to its earlier full-year financial forecasts and focusing on cost control.
“Nevertheless, the economic climate remains unstable, and the resulting uncertainty continues to generate significant volatility,” it added. “TF1 Group has the strengths needed to cope with the uncertainties of its environment, and will continue through 2012 with its strategy of enhancing its free-to-air multi channel offering and building its digital businesses, supported by the dynamism of its diversification activities.”
